Abstract

The utility model discloses a mining single hydraulic prop, and relates to a mining device as a support in a mine. The mining single hydraulic prop comprises: a top cover, a moveable column, a moveable column upper cover, a cylinder body, a cylinder body upper cover, a return spring, a handgrip body three-purpose valve, and a base. The moveable column can not be used due to pocking marks formed at the surface of the moveable column, in order to save cost, a repairing layer made from resin materials is sprayed at the surface of the moveable column, and a wear-resistant layer made from polyurethane materials is sticked to the sealing surface of a sealing ring, and the quality of the repaired moveable column is the same as the quality of a new moveable column. The mining single hydraulic prop is advantageous in that, the moveable repairing layer is made from resin materials, the sealing ring wear-resistant layer is made from polyurethane materials, and the hardness and wear resistance of the above two are close, sealing effect is good, service lifetime is long, and quality of the single hydraulic prop is guaranteed; the mining single hydraulic prop is also advantaged by simple repairing technology, high efficiency, and easy popularization and use.

Background technology
Floated mine individual hydraulic prop, big with its lifting force, advantage such as safe and reliable is widely used in colliery underworkings and the work plane equipment as supporting.Because the work condition environment condition is too poor under the coal mine, especially when blowing out, the stone wound is hit the post of living, and forms pit on the post surface of living, the influence sealing, and the pillar lifting force descends, and pillar can't use when serious, have to scrap, must be from the pillar that newly more renews.But other positions of pillar still are intact, if will live post surface repairing and reusing, will reduce cost significantly.
